A Frugal Vacation
🧺 Backyard “World’s Fair”
💡 Invite friends or neighbors to represent a country for the day. Cook a dish, share a phrase, play a song, wear something colorful. Use what you have—cardboard signs, homemade flags, and lots of curiosity.

💸 — PAY DAY
“Anyone who’s ever stretched a budget, balanced a month, or worried over a bill will recognize a bit of themselves in Pay Day — but in the sweetest, most lighthearted way possible.
It’s the kind of game that takes real-life stress and turns it into something fun, familiar, and surprisingly comforting.
I love this classic edition because it keeps things simple:
you earn, you spend, you save, you hit surprises… and you laugh your way through the ups and downs instead of feeling weighed down by them.
It’s playful, a bit nostalgic, and just the right reminder that even when money feels tight, there’s always a way through.
What makes it special to me is how it brings people together to talk, strategize, and support one another — the same way real families do when times are tricky.
A little humour, a little planning, a little luck.
A perfect cozy-night-in game for frugal hearts, practical thinkers, and anyone who appreciates making the most of what they’ve got.”*
